Effect of Modal Interaction on Transient Behavior in Double-Input SEPIC DC–DC Converters
International Journal of Bifurcation and Chaos ( IF 1.9 ) Pub Date : 2020-09-01 , DOI: 10.1142/s021812742050145x
Hao Zhang 1 , Min Jing 1, 2 , Shuai Dong 1, 3 , Wei Liu 1 , Zhaohua Cui 1
Affiliation  

In this paper, we exploit an idea of nonlinear modal series method to investigate the effects of modal interaction in the one-cycle controlled (OCC) double-input SEPIC DC–DC converter. Based on the proposed nonlinear averaged model, the analytical approximate solutions are obtained to characterize the dynamic response characteristic of the transient behaviors in the double-input SEPIC converters. The fundamental modal analysis is utilized to identify the dominant oscillation modes and discover the relationship between parameters, fundamental modes and state variables. Furthermore, the second-order interaction indices are proposed to uncover the underlying mechanism of nonlinear interaction behaviors. In particular, the correlation between parameters and modal interaction are derived to optimize the transient process of the double-input SEPIC converters. Finally, numerical simulations are performed to verify the theoretical analysis.
